AI tools like chatbots and virtual assistants can support you as you complete your application. For example, they can check for spelling or grammar errors, or help you to decide what to include.

But they shouldn’t replace your own responses or be used to write the application for you.

Relying too much on AI can negatively impact your chances of success, because automatically generated answers:

  • might not be specific or relevant enough to address the criteria in the recruitment profile
  • often seem generic and not personalised enough – an AI response won’t show your unique voice and perspective
  • could misrepresent information about you, such as your qualifications, skills and experience

We monitor applications for any behaviour that could create an unfair advantage, and we check all references carefully. You are likely to be tested on your experience at interview, so be honest and make sure all the information in your application is correct.

Trosolwg o'r swydd

Glenfield Hospital Theatres are recruiting experienced Band 5 nurses with cardiac scrub experience and Operating Department Practitioners within our Cardiac Theatre Team!

There is excellent scope for learning and advancement within our theatres and we have our own dedicated Education Team and on the ground clinical skills supervisors, to help you develop and progress in your career. 

 

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d

  • To co-ordinate and provide skilled clinical practise (without direct supervision) to patients, in accordance with responsibilities under NMC/HCPC Code of Conduct.

  • To contribute to the continued development of Nurses/Operating Department Practitioners (ODPs), including the supervision of junior nurses/ODPs and support staff.

  • Responsible for assessing, planning, implementing and evaluating programmes of evidenced-based clinical care to a group of patients.

  • Assist and contribute to the management and organisation of a theatre or unit

  • Actively contribute to setting and maintaining high standards of quality nursing/ODP care.

  • Actively participate in the education, development and supervision of other staff members.

  • Act as a clinical and professional role model, mentoring, assessing and supporting students and learners on placement within the clinical area.

  • Work collaboratively and co-operatively with others to meet the needs of patients and their families.
